How much horsepower does a 2004 Lexus RX300 have?

Horsepower of a 2004 Lexus RX300
The 2004 Lexus RX300 has 230 horsepower at 5,600 rpm. This information is based on the specifications provided by Autoblog.

Is Lexus RX300 a V-6 engine?

The first-generation RX 300, fitted with a 3.0-liter V6 engine, began sales in 1998.

How fast is a Lexus RX300?

The Lexus RX I 300 top speed is 180 Km/h / 112 mph.

What Lexus goes 200 mph?

Lexus LF-A concept
The Lexus LF-A concept features an engine capable of developing more than 500 horsepower from a displacement of less than five litres. With a combination of optimum gearing, weight and aerodynamics, the LF-A concept would produce a top speed in the region of 200 miles per hour.

How many miles per gallon does a 2004 Lexus RX300 get?

Based on data from 7 vehicles, 227 fuel-ups and 61,475 miles of driving, the 2004 Lexus RX300 gets a combined Avg MPG of 18.53 with a 0.52 MPG margin of error.
